Course Content

1. Quality Leadership and Integration

A. Strategic Planning
  • Advise leadership on organizational improvement opportunities
  • Assist with the development of action plans or projects
  • Assist with establishing priorities
  • Participate in activities that support the quality governance infrastructure
  • Align quality and safety activities with strategic goals
B. Stakeholder Engagement
  • Identify resource needs to improve quality
  • Assess the organization’s culture of quality and safety
  • Engage stakeholders to promote quality and safety
  • Provide consultative support to the governing body and key stakeholders regarding their roles and responsibilities related to quality improvement
  • Promote engagement and inter-professional teamwork

2. Performance and Process Improvement

  • Implement quality improvement training
  • Communicate quality improvement information within the organization
  • Identify quality improvement opportunities
  • Establish teams, roles, responsibilities, and scope
  • Participate in activities to identify innovative or evidence-based practices
  • Lead and facilitate change
  • Use performance improvement methods (e.g., Lean, PDSA, Six Sigma)
  • Use quality tools and techniques (e.g., fishbone diagram, FMEA, process map)
  • Participate in monitoring of project timelines and deliverables
  • Evaluate team effectiveness
  • Evaluate the success of performance improvement projects and solutions

3. Population Health and Care Transitions

  • Identify data and resources that are important in determining the health status of
    defined populations
  • Identify population health management strategies to integrate into improvement
    initiatives
  • Incorporate prevention, wellness, and disease management solutions into
    improvement initiatives
  • Incorporate techniques to address health disparities and promote equity into
    improvement initiatives
  • Analyze and use clinical, cost, equity, and social determinants of health data to drive and monitor improvement efforts
  • Identify opportunities for improvement in care transitions
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to improve and optimize care processes and
    transitions
  • Incorporate concepts of social determinants of health into improvement activities

4. Health Data Analytics

A. Data Management Systems
  • Assist in evaluating and developing data management systems to support quality
    improvement
  • Design data collection plans:
    1. Measure development (e.g. definitions, goals, thresholds, numerators,
      and denominators)
    2. Tools and techniques
    3. Sampling methodology
  • Identify and select measures (e.g. structure, process, outcome, experience)
  • Collect and validate quantitative and qualitative data
  • Identify external data sources for comparison and benchmarking
  • Design scorecards and dashboards for different audiences
B. Measurement and Analysis
  • Use data management systems for organization, analysis, and reporting of data
  • Use data visualization and display techniques
  • Use measurement tools to evaluate process improvement
  • Use statistics to describe data and examine relationships (e.g., measures of central tendency, standard deviation, correlation, regression, t-test)
  • Use statistical process control techniques and tools (e.g., common and special cause variation, control charts, trend analysis)
  • Compare data sources to establish benchmarks
  • Interpret data to support decision-making

5. Patient Safety

  • Identify technology solutions to enhance patient safety
  • Facilitate the ongoing evaluation of safety activities
  • Apply techniques to enhance the culture of safety within the organization
  • Integrate safety concepts throughout the organization
  • Use safety principles (e.g., human factors engineering, high reliability, high-performance teams, systems thinking)
  • Participate in safety and risk management activities related to:
    1. Safety event/incident reporting
    2. Sentinel/unexpected event review
    3. Root cause analysis
    4. Proactive risk assessment

6. Quality Review and Accountability

  • Apply standards, best practices, and other information from quality-related organizations
  • Evaluate compliance with internal and external requirements for:
    1. Clinical practice guidelines, pathways, and outcomes
    2. Quality-based payment programs
    3. Documentation
    4. Practitioner performance evaluation
    5. Patient experience
    6. Identification of reportable events for accreditation and regulatory bodies
  • Maintain confidentiality of performance/quality improvement records and reports
  • Implement and evaluate quality initiatives that impact reimbursement

7. Regulatory and Accreditation

  • Evaluate appropriate accreditation, certification, and recognition options
  • Promote awareness of statutory and regulatory requirements within the organization
  • Support processes for evaluating, monitoring, and improving compliance with organizational, state, and federal requirements
  • Maintain survey or accreditation readiness
